Stresses above those listed under “Absolute Maximum  
Ratings” may cause permanent damage to the device.  
This is a stress rating only and the functional operation of  
the device at these or any conditions other than those indi-  
cated in the operational sections of this specification is not  
implied. Exposure to absolute maximum rating conditions  
for extended periods may affect device reliability.
